Spain’s national railway company, Renfe, is offering bullet train tickets between Spain’s two largest cities, Barcelona and Madrid, for just €22.

The offer is for tickets on Renfe’s low-cost service, Avlo, which began operating between the two cities in 2021. And it’s not just for Barcelona and Madrid, but for travel between all nine Avlo destinations.

Moving at up to 330 kilometres per hour, the Avlo trains will travel the 600 kilometres between Barcelona and Madrid in as little as 150 minutes, although most trains will make more stops and take about three hours.

There are 21 departures a day from 0630 til 20:40

Japan’s fastest bullet trains take about 150 minutes to travel about 550 kilometres between Tokyo and Osaka, but at a cost of about $140.

Spain’s high-speed rail network is slightly longer than Japan’s 3,041 kilometres, according to the International Union of Railways. At 3,330 kilometres long, it’s the second longest in the world after China’s enormous 35,000 kilometre network.
